空心玻璃微球化学镀镍的前处理工艺研究

Study on Pretreatment Technology for Electroless Nickel Plating on Hollow Glass Microspheres

【摘要】 研究了对空心玻璃微球化学镀镍的几种前处理方法。通过比较不同方法产生的活化效果及镀后产物形貌 ,认为先对空心玻璃微球进行偶联处理 ,可以增加微球表面活性点 ,加快化学镀反应速度 ,提高微球表面包覆率。

【Abstract】 Several pretreatment methods for electroless nickel plating on hollow glass microspheres were investigated. A new pretreatment technology that treating hollow glass microspheres with coupling agent solution was proposed through comparison of the activation effect and morphology of plating products produced by different pretreatment methods. This pretreatment technology can increase the number of active spots on surface of the treated glass spheres, improve the plating speed, and can increase covering rate of surface of the hollow glass microspheres.
